FIGURE 6 in Molecular phylogenetic analysis and comparative morphology reveals the diversity and distribution of needle nematodes of the genus Longidorus (Dorylaimida: Longidoridae) from Spain

Authors: Archidona-Yuste, Antonio; Cantalapiedra-Navarrete, Carolina; Castillo, Pablo; Palomares-Rius, Juan E.;

FIGURE 6 in Molecular phylogenetic analysis and comparative morphology reveals the diversity and distribution of needle nematodes of the genus Longidorus (Dorylaimida: Longidoridae) from Spain

Abstract

Published as part of Archidona-Yuste, Antonio, Cantalapiedra-Navarrete, Carolina, Castillo, Pablo & Palomares-Rius, Juan E., 2019, Molecular phylogenetic analysis and comparative morphology reveals the diversity and distribution of needle nematodes of the genus Longidorus (Dorylaimida: Longidoridae) from Spain, pp. 1-41 in Contributions to Zoology 88 on page 21, DOI: 10.1163/18759866-20191345, http://zenodo.org/record/10831995

FIGURE 6 Light micrographs of Longidorus iliturgiensis, sp. nov. (A)–(D) Anterior regions. (E) Vulval region. (F)–(I) Female tails. (J)–(M) First-, second-, third-, and fourth-stage juvenile (J1–J4) tails, respectively. (N)–(O) Male tail. Abbreviations: a = anus; af = amphidial fovea; spl = ventromedian supplements; v = vulva. Scale bars (A)–(C), (E)–(O) = 20 μm; (D) = 10 μm
